Why Sensitive Formulations Need UV-Blocking Glass Packaging

Violet glass packaging exists to solve one specific problem: continuous light exposure changes the colour, aroma, and stability of food, cosmetic, and supplement contents. Violet glass — also described in the industry as biophotonic glass — acts as a natural filter that blocks visible light while allowing approximately 25%–45% penetration of UVA and 60% of infrared light, a transmission profile intended to preserve organic contents (Miron Violetglass, “The Science of Violet Glass”).

Comparison of UV protection of various coloured glass bottles used for light-sensitive contents
Comparison of UV protection across coloured glass bottles — violet glass sits at the protective end of the range.

Against amber glass, Honor Packaging’s own comparison of coloured glass bottles lists violet glass as providing better protection against ultraviolet rays and better maintenance of product freshness, at a cost approximately 15% higher than amber. That comparison places violet glass in food packaging, cosmetic packaging, and pharmaceutical packaging.

Two limits follow directly from those two points, and both belong in a 2026 purchasing decision. First, the cost gap is a real planning input rather than a rounding error: about 15% above amber glass at the same format. Second, the protection claim rests on light-transmittance behaviour — it does not replace a stability test on the finished formulation. Buyers moving from amber or clear glass should confirm compatibility on their own product before committing a full production run.

Protective Packaging in 2026: The Market Context

Demand for protective packaging is expanding, and the light-protection segment sits inside that growth. The global protective packaging market was valued at USD 44.02 billion in 2025 and is projected to reach USD 80.25 billion by 2034, according to Fortune Business Insights. Grand View Research estimated the same market at USD 40.4 billion in 2025, with the flexible segment holding a 66.4% revenue share. The two figures differ because research firms segment the category differently — a divergence worth noting when a market-size number is used in a business case.

Material and segment data point in the same direction. Paper and paperboard held a 45.7% revenue share of protective packaging in 2025, driven by sustainability trends (Grand View Research), while the secondary packaging segment is anticipated to hold 48.54% of the packaging market by 2026 (Fortune Business Insights). Rigid violet glass formats sit in the smaller, function-led part of this market: they are specified where light protection, not cushioning, is the primary job.

Regulation shapes closure design as much as market size does. In the EU, child-resistant packaging is assessed against ISO/EN 8317; in the US, the reference is 16 CFR 1700.20. Both are intended to prevent access by children under five (ISO/EN 8317; CPSC). For violet glass buyers, that makes child resistance a requirement to specify at the start of a project rather than a cap option to choose at the end of it.

Frequently Asked Questions

Which violet glass jar series come with a child-resistant cap?

H21 round violet glass jars (item codes H21-0012V to H21-0018V) and H21 square violet glass jars (H21-0003V to H21-0008V) list a child-resistant cap as their cap specification. HDV2 and HDV1 include item codes with a “-CR” suffix — HDV2005M-CR and HDV1100M-1-CR — in their published code lists; because the published data for those two series lists closure materials rather than closure function, buyers who require child resistance on those formats should confirm the cap specification directly. Where child resistance is regulated, the EU reference standard is ISO/EN 8317 and the US reference is 16 CFR 1700.20, both designed to prevent access by children under five. Cap configuration is one input to that assessment, and the complete closure assembly should be confirmed for the destination market.
